免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

湖北k歌小程序开发工具在哪里

湖北K歌小程序是一款专业唱歌平台,通过小程序的方式提供了歌曲在线收听和在线录制的服务。不仅如此,还提供了录制后自动修音和混音的功能,仿佛进入了真正的录音棚一般,深受用户喜爱。那么,这款小程序背后的开发工具又是什么呢?

一、开发工具:小程序开发者工具

湖北K歌小程序使用的是小程序开发者工具进行开发。小程序开发者工具支持实时预览,可以模拟用户手机上的运行效果。在开发过程中,还可以使用工具中的调试模式,帮助开发者快速定位问题。小程序开发者工具还提供了代码编辑、上传代码、调试等功能,帮助开发者提高开发效率。

二、开发流程

1.注册小程序账号

在使用小程序开发者工具之前,需要先注册小程序账号,成为小程序开发者。可以通过微信公众平台或微信开放平台进行注册。

2.创建小程序项目

注册完小程序账号之后,可以使用小程序开发者工具创建小程序项目。在创建新项目时,需要填写小程序名称、AppID、小程序路径等信息。

3.开发小程序页面

开发页面是小程序开发的主要部分。在小程序开发者工具中,可以创建小程序页面、组件等。编写页面时,使用类似HTML和CSS的标记语言WXML和WXSS。

4.上传代码

开发完成后,需要将代码上传至小程序平台。可以使用小程序开发者工具中的上传代码功能。上传成功后,可以在小程序平台的开发管理界面中进行版本管理、提交审核等操作。

5.发布小程序

小程序审核通过之后,就可以发布小程序了。在小程序平台开发管理界面中,可以将开发版本发布为线上版本。线上版本发布成功之后,用户就可以在微信中搜索并使用小程序了。

三、湖北K歌小程序架构

(1)前端技术

湖北K歌小程序的前端技术采用了微信小程序的开发框架,即WXML、WXSS和JS语言,小程序开发使用了ES6、ES7等前端技术语言,实现了小程序的页面渲染效果,以及数据请求与交互操作等。

(2)后端技术

湖北K歌小程序采用了基于微信云开发的后端技术。云开发是微信小程序提供的一种云端开发平台,为开发者提供了数据库、云函数、存储等服务。在湖北K歌小程序中,云开发提供了录音上传、歌曲推荐、音频处理等功能,实现了对小程序的后端支持。

(3)运行环境

湖北K歌小程序的运行环境是微信小程序,支持微信iOS和Android客户端。小程序通过微信提供的接口与微信客户端进行通信,实现了小程序的页面渲染、数据请求等。

四、总结

湖北K歌小程序采用了微信小程序开发框架进行开发,通过WXML和WXSS等前端技术语言实现了小程序的页面渲染和交互效果。同时,小程序还使用了微信云开发等后端技术,实现了录音上传、歌曲推荐等功能。在小程序开发中,可以使用小程序开发者工具进行开发、调试和发布操作。


相关知识:
vue开发小程序需要的技术
Vue开发小程序需要掌握以下技术:1. Vue.js知识Vue.js是一个流行的JavaScript框架,用于构建交互式前端应用程序。Vue.js具有易于使用的模块化结构和数据绑定功能,可以帮助开发人员构建高效、可维护和易于扩展的应用程序。在开发小程序时,
2023-08-09
react native开发微信小程序
React Native 是由 Facebook 开源和维护的一种基于 JavaScript 的框架,它可以让开发者用同一组代码完成 iOS 和 Android 平台上的原生应用程序的开发。而微信小程序是一种无需安装,即用即走的小型应用程序。本文将详细介绍
2023-08-09
python简单小程序开发
Python是一种开放源码的高级编程语言,在程序设计中非常常见。它易于学习、易于使用、高效、可读性强,并且具有强大的功能特性。Python可以用于从简单应用到复杂的大型项目。这里将介绍如何用Python编写一个简单的小程序。1.编写程序文件运行Python
2023-08-09
python开发小程序商城
Python开发小程序商城是采用Python语言进行开发的一套商城系统,能够实现商品展示、购物车、订单管理、支付等功能的综合性微信小程序。下面将详细介绍Python开发小程序商城的原理以及具体实现方法。一、Python语言的优势Python语言有着极高的可
2023-08-09
java微信小程序开发用户登录
微信小程序是一种轻量级的应用程序,具有体验好、容易传播、使用方便、功能强大的特点。在小程序的开发中,用户登录是一个必不可少的环节,而Java是广泛应用的编程语言,我们可以通过Java来实现微信小程序的用户登录。1. 微信登录的原理微信登录的原理是通过微信开
2023-08-09
hbuilder 微信小程序开发
HBuilder是一款功能十分强大的前端开发IDE,支持各种前端开发语言和框架,包括HTML5、CSS3、JavaScript、Vue.js等,并且内置了调试、构建和打包工具。其中,HBuilder还支持开发微信小程序,并提供了非常友好的开发环境和调试工具
2023-08-09
app开发小程序定制
随着智能手机普及,越来越多的人使用移动应用程序(APP)来解决各种生活需求。但是,作为一个创业公司或者小商家,开发一个APP对于资金、技术和时间成本都非常高昂。因此,小程序成为了很多人的选择。小程序是一种轻量级的应用程序,不需要下载和安装,直接通过微信、支
2023-08-09
0基础学开发小程序要多久
学习开发小程序不需要很长时间,通常可以在几个月内掌握基本知识,但这也取决于你的学习速度和学习方式。下面将介绍一些可以帮助你快速学习开发小程序的基础知识和技巧。1. 充分准备在开始学习开发小程序之前,最好先了解一些基本的编程概念和语言,例如JavaScrip
2023-08-09
gcc打包进exe
在本教程中,我们将了解如何使用GCC(GNU编译器集合)将C语言源代码打包成Windows下的可执行文件(*.exe)。我们将首先了解编译原理,然后给出详细的步骤。一、原理介绍:GCC是一个功能强大的编译器,被用于编译许多编程语言(如C、C++和Fortr
2023-05-26
微信小程序开发工具视频教程
微信小程序是一种轻量级的应用程序,用户可以在微信内部直接使用,无需下载安装。由于其轻巧、快速、便捷的特点,它受到越来越多开发者的关注和喜爱。那么,如何进行微信小程序开发呢?本篇文章将介绍微信小程序开发工具视频教程。首先,我们需要下载微信开发者工具。此工具是
2023-05-26
微信小程序开发工具怎么测试版本号
微信小程序开发工具是一款非常实用的工具,为小程序开发者提供了便利。在编写小程序时,开发者通常需要进行版本号的管理。版本号是指开发者在每次发布小程序时,为小程序定义的一个标志。版本号的变化标志着小程序的升级或更新。那么,微信小程序开发工具如何进行版本号的测试
2023-05-26
临武微信小程序开发工具
临武微信小程序开发工具是一种可以帮助用户快速创建微信小程序的开发环境。它包括了代码编辑器、调试器和预览器等多个功能模块,可以帮助用户方便的进行开发、调试和发布等操作。临武微信小程序开发工具基于微信官方的开发工具平台,具有以下主要特点:1. 统一的开发环境和
2023-05-26